Transaction a63f2ef9adb35230c8e348b24843c652dfd9eb50ddb646b1ee263b646bb63593
2 Input
2 Outputs
- a63f2ef9adb35230c8e348b24843c652dfd9eb50ddb646b1ee263b646bb63593:0
- a63f2ef9adb35230c8e348b24843c652dfd9eb50ddb646b1ee263b646bb63593:1
value 21117006
address 3BpwMXtybdhRVp1mstyuxxgLRaT4CjdccJ
value 985994
address 19fNCtTDaSVoygr3jQvmz4kYK4b8wM5HMF